The first priority for earning money for every blogger is Google AdSense. Before learning about high CPC keywords and how they can enhance your earnings, you should understand what Google AdSense is. High CPC keywords are crucial in digital marketing. Businesses in fast-growing industries highly seek them.
Discover high paying AdSense keywords to maximize your website’s earnings and attract premium advertisers in 2025.
The fastest growing industries, such as cyber security and digital marketing, are expanding rapidly. This is due to increased online activity and demand for digital advertising. They can significantly increase advertising revenue.

AdSense is a Google initiative. It runs ads that are based on CPC, or cost per click, on your blogs and websites. Your blog or website must completely comply with the rules of the Adsense privacy policy. Then, Google Adsense will give you permission. You can then run its ads on your website.
Thus, you can earn decent money. Once you place the Google ad code on your website, it will display Google ads. When your visitor clicks on your ads, you will earn money online. But low CPC keywords with high search volume will give good traffic with low earnings.
Some keywords have very large search volumes. When conducting keyword research, you can use people search tools to understand what users are searching for. These tools help to assess traffic volume and keyword effectiveness.
This is especially true in the finance space and real estate niche. These factors make them highly attractive for advertisers. Industries like real estate often have high CPCs, especially for keywords related to selling a house or financing.
For example, keywords related to legal services in the legal industry are among the most competitive. Real estate agent keywords with descriptive terms like “fast” or “with cash” can greatly improve ad performance. They enhance cost per click effectiveness. Those in the finance space and real estate niche are also high-paying in the industry.
Advertisers in these industries allocate significant advertising dollars to advertise on high-value keywords. Small businesses seeking business loans generate high search volume. Those looking for working capital also attract high CPCs. This combination makes them valuable targets for advertisers. This practice contributes to Google’s advertising revenue. I
t allows Google to make the most money from search ads. Understanding which industries and keywords are most profitable is crucial for maximizing your AdSense earnings. Online learning is rapidly growing.
This sector has high CPC potential due to the popularity of virtual education. Certification courses also contribute to this potential. The most profitable keywords often have top CPC values in industries like insurance, medical, legal, and real estate. These values illustrate the competitive bidding and advertising costs in each sector.
The most profitable keywords often have top CPC values in industries like insurance, medical, legal, and real estate. This illustrates the competitive bidding and advertising costs in each sector.
High paying AdSense keywords and top paying keywords for AdSense are the backbone of better earnings for publishers in 2025
We’ve curated the latest top paying keywords for AdSense that consistently deliver the highest revenue per click.
Low Competition + High CPC Keywords = Money Online
What is the meaning of High CPC?
Before knowing the answer to this question, you need to know how much money you can earn from Google Adsense. Google Adsense will give you money for every click you get on your website ad. This money for a click is known as the keyword cost or cost per click (CPC). It varies from a few cents to a few dollars.
The variation depends on the industry, the average CPC, and the specific keywords you target. Keyword costs can be influenced by competition, industry, and the relevance of the keywords chosen.
Well, now the tricky question can be answered. A high CPC keyword is one that will give you more dollars for fewer clicks. For example, the keyword instant auto insurance quote is having nearly $69.72 CPC price.
Certain keywords related to insurance, legal, and finance often have the highest costs. They are considered expensive keywords. Sometimes, they are even the most expensive keyword in their category.
Target the most profitable keywords for AdSense to improve your site’s monetization and overall traffic value.
The Adsense earnings also depend on the country you get visitors from. Traffic from some countries will provide a lower CPC for the keywords. Other countries will pay a higher CPC for the same keywords.
The most expensive keyword in some industries can reach the highest CPCs. Advertisers closely monitor keyword costs and CPCs. They do this to manage their advertising budget and avoid the highest cost per click.
What is CPC?
The CPC is abbreviated as “cost per click.” The CPC is the amount the advertiser pays you for the ad that runs on your website. This advertiser’s money is paid to you through Google.
The CPC varies with each different ad and also with each different click you get. As we discussed earlier, this CPC also varies with the visitors from each country. Advertisers often analyze average CPC and keyword cost data to estimate their potential earnings and manage keyword costs effectively. Understanding how keyword costs fluctuate across industries and regions helps advertisers control their overall costs and optimize their ad campaigns.
Other than CPC:
The question is, are there any other means than only CPC, which is cost per click? Yes, there is. Adsense also pays you for impressions you get on your page, which is called CPM. Understanding both CPC and CPM costs is important. This knowledge helps in optimizing your ad revenue. It also aids in making informed decisions about your advertising strategy.
The standard CPM for every page is $1 for 1000 impressions. You earn $3 each day. This happens if you have 1000 daily visitors and display 3 ads on a single page. In this way, you can earn up to $100 with daily traffic of 1000 visitors.
What are High CPC Keywords?
Knowing how to find high CPC keywords helps you target the most profitable keywords AdSense advertisers are bidding on. To earn with Adsense, you need to do intense keyword research before writing error-free content. Target high CPC niches for your posts. After your initial research, take time to conduct your own keyword research. Use tools like Keyword Planner to identify relevant keywords. Find high-value search terms that match your content and audience.
The only result will be if you receive more clicks on such high CPC keywords. In that case, you will earn a high income. Google AdSense keywords play a crucial role in optimizing your content for maximum advertising income. Update your blog with the most top paying AdSense keywords to increase your chances of higher ad payouts.
You can get the most expensive keywords. However, it is tougher to rank these keywords on the first page of Google. You need to do a lot of back-end work to rank your pages. Of course, you can pick “car insurance,” “auto insurance,” “make money online,” etc. as keywords for better revenue.
When considering high-paying keywords, note that specific categories are often targeted in search ads. These include loan keywords, business loans, insurance keywords, and real estate agents. They are targeted due to their high CPC and commercial intent.
Below are the highest paying pay per clicks in all of the Google Adsense advertisements. You can utilize them to make a post or a niche site. These are high-cost keywords for Adsense.
Here is the list of high-paying AdSense niches for Adsense and YouTube in 2025.
| High CPC Keywords | CPC (in $) |
|---|---|
| Insurance | $57 |
| Gas/Electricity | $57 |
| Mortgage | $47 |
| Attorney | $47 |
| Loans | $44 |
| Lawyer | $42 |
| Donate | $42 |
| Conference Call | $42 |
| Degree | $40 |
| Credit | $38 |
The above-given keywords are very difficult to rank because of the already heavy competition. To improve your chances, use negative keywords to avoid paying for irrelevant clicks.
Target the most profitable keywords for AdSense to improve your site’s monetization and overall traffic value.
Focus on optimizing your landing pages. Enhance your conversion rates for better ad placements and higher ad rank.
Quality score in Google Ads is important. Set up your Google Ads account properly. Monitor for fake clicks. Continually refine your campaigns to maximize ROI.
The top 25 most expensive keywords in Google 2025 are as follows:
| Keyword | Average CPC |
|---|---|
| Business Services | $58.64 |
| Bail Bonds | $58.48 |
| Casino | $55.48 |
| Lawyer | $54.86 |
| Asset Management | $49.86 |
| Insurance | $48.41 |
| Cash Services & Payday Loans | $48.18 |
| Cleanup & Restoration Services | $47.61 |
| Degree | $47.36 |
| Medical Coding Services | $46.84 |
| Rehab | $46.14 |
| Psychic | $43.78 |
| Timeshare | $42.13 |
| HVAC | $41.24 |
| Business Software | $41.12 |
| Medical Needs | $40.73 |
| Loans | $40.69 |
| Plumber | $39.19 |
| Termites | $38.88 |
| Pest Control | $38.84 |
| Mortgages | $36.76 |
| Online Gambling | $32.84 |
| Banking | $31.43 |
| Hair Transplant | $31.37 |
| Google AdWords | $30.06 |
Google AdSense keywords like insurance, mortgage, and legal terms are among the top paying AdSense keywords. The most profitable keywords AdSense publishers can focus on are also the highest paying keywords in competitive industries.
Please note: The keyword data provided here is for editorial purposes only. Advertisers should always do their own research before making advertising decisions.
What is Google Ads?
Google Ads is a powerful advertising platform. It enables businesses to display their ads across Google’s search engine. It also reaches a vast network of partner websites. At the heart of Google Ads is keyword targeting.
Businesses select relevant and specific keywords. Their potential customers are likely to use these keywords when searching for products or services. By carefully choosing these keywords, advertisers can ensure their ads appear in front of the right audience. They reach the audience at the right time.
When users enter keywords into Google, the platform matches those search terms with ads that are most relevant. If your chosen keywords closely match what your target audience is searching for, your ads will appear more frequently.
This alignment significantly increases the probability of visibility. Using relevant keywords not only increases your ad’s visibility. It also improves the likelihood of attracting qualified leads. These leads are more likely to convert into customers.
Understanding how Google Ads works is crucial for businesses. It allows them to make informed decisions about which keywords to target. Businesses learn how to structure their campaigns.
They also understand how to allocate their advertising budget for maximum impact. By focusing on specific keywords that match user intent, businesses can drive more targeted traffic. They can improve their ad performance. Businesses also achieve better results from their advertising efforts.
What is Keyword Categories
When it comes to maximizing your Google Ads performance and boosting your AdSense earnings, understanding keyword categories is absolutely essential. Keyword categories are groups of related keywords.
They share similar characteristics such as high cost per click (CPC), large search volumes, or niche specificity.
By mastering keyword categories, advertisers and publishers can make smarter advertising decisions. They can optimize their advertising budget. This approach ultimately drives more conversions and revenue.
Industry-Specific Keywords
Industry-specific keywords are essential for businesses aiming to reach the right audience and boost their online presence. Companies can target keywords related to their industry. This strategy helps them connect with users who are actively searching for products or services they offer.
Unlock the highest paying keywords for Google AdSense and transform your blog into a revenue-generating machine. Use the given comprehensive list of top CPC AdSense keywords to get more earnings from every click in 2025.
For example, in the insurance industry, companies should use specific keywords like “car insurance” or “health insurance.” This helps attract users looking for insurance solutions. This increases the chances of generating qualified leads.
Focusing on industry-related keywords is crucial. It ensures that your ads reach people who are most likely to be interested in what you offer. This targeted approach improves the effectiveness of your Google Ads campaigns. It also helps you stand out in a competitive market.
By identifying and using industry-specific keywords, businesses can enhance their visibility. They can drive more relevant traffic. Ultimately, businesses achieve better results from their digital marketing efforts.
How to Find High Paying Keywords by using SEMRUSH? (High CPC Keywords)
SEMrush is an all-in-one internet marketing service. It provides the following professional services: PPC keyword finding, SEO, and keyword research. For more details, see my SEMrush Review 2025.
I explained how to use SEMrush for better ranking. When aiming to rank higher, keep in mind that search engines are crucial for driving traffic.
Learn how to find high CPC keywords using proven research strategies and the latest digital marketing tools for 2025. Be superior to competitors by using top paying AdSense keywords that are proven to deliver outstanding results.
Stay ahead with the latest high CPC keywords 2025 and position your content for premium advertiser bids. Understanding people’s search behavior can help you target what users are actually looking for.
Now let’s start with how to use SEMrush to find high CPC keywords in USA 2025 on other sites.
By Using SEMrush: You can find high-CPC keywords from SEMrush by following these steps. Firstly, find your competitor and enter the domain in the SEMrush keyword tool. Next, click on the “full report” button and then click on “top organic keywords.” Then the list will show the top indexed pages on Google for that site. Now click on the CPC section and order it to be viewed in descending order. And finally, you will get the most expensive keywords from that site. In the same way, search all the competitor’s sites and make a list. After using SEMrush, first combine it with Keyword Planner. This combination helps you identify the most relevant and specific keywords for your niche. Performing your own keyword research is essential for finding the best opportunities.
When targeting high CPC keywords, optimize your landing pages. Monitor conversion rates to help you maximize the value of your traffic.
Explore our updated list of top paying Google AdSense keywords to find new opportunities in high-value industries. Attract advertisers searching for top paying keywords to grow your AdSense income faster than ever.
SEMrush provides two types of accounts for its users. They are free and premium. You can use a free account for this analysis.
Step 1: Signup SEMRush account
To uncover the best industry-specific keywords, start by signing up for a SEMRush account. SEMRush offers a robust database filled with specific keywords and keywords related to virtually any industry.

Once you have access, you can begin searching for keywords that are directly relevant to your business sector. This step is crucial for discovering the terms your target audience is using. It also helps in identifying new opportunities to reach potential customers within your industry.
Step 2: Choose Organic Keywords
You have access to the SEMRush database. The next step is to identify organic keywords. These keywords should be relevant to your industry and have strong search potential.

Look for keywords related to your products or services that users are already searching for. Select the right organic keywords. This can improve your website’s visibility in search results. It can also attract more qualified visitors who are interested in what your business has to offer.
Step 3: Pick high CPC
First, gather a list of Top organic keywords. Next, filter them by cost per click (CPC). This process will help you pinpoint the most expensive keywords in your industry. These expensive keywords are often referred to as high CPC or CPC keywords.

They typically have the highest competition. They also have the greatest potential for driving valuable traffic. By targeting the most expensive keywords, you can tap into search terms.
Advertisers are willing to pay a premium for these terms. This maximizes your potential advertising revenue. It also enhances your online exposure.
Step 4: Descending the CPC
Once you’ve identified high CPC keywords, sort them in descending order based on their cost per click. This will help you focus on the most expensive keywords in your industry. It will give you a clear view of where the highest advertising value lies.

Targeting these keywords can increase your visibility. It can also attract more traffic. However, it’s important to remember that they are highly competitive. You may need to adjust your bid strategy and advertising budget to compete effectively for these top spots.
By following these steps, businesses can conduct thorough keyword research and create highly targeted Google Ads campaigns. Using negative keywords helps filter out irrelevant searches, ensuring your ads reach only the most interested users.
Optimizing your landing pages and improving your quality score can boost your ad rank and lower your cost per click. With a well-planned bid strategy, you can optimize your advertising budget. Focus on the most expensive keywords to drive better results from your Google Ads campaigns.
Conduct your own keyword research with tools like SEMRush and Keyword Planner. This approach ensures you’re always targeting the best keywords for your industry. It helps you stay ahead in the competitive world of digital marketing.
Now you have a huge list of profitable keywords that you can use to increase your Adsense earnings and traffic. This research process is applicable to all niches. Pick the 14-day free SEMRush account to get more top-paying Adsense keywords.

- Organizing content
- Creating and optimizing content
- Measuring the effectiveness of your content, and so on
- Today, get a 14-day free trial of a SEMrush Pro/Guru account.
Highest Paying AdSense CPC Countries
You can analyze a list of top paying Google AdSense keywords. This allows you to identify top CPC AdSense keywords that drive maximum revenue.
Focus on highest CPC AdSense keywords to ensure you get the maximum returns from every page view and visitor. Here are some of the countries that have the highest average CPCs in Google AdSense:
| Rank | Country | Approx CPC (USD) | Notes / Niches That Perform Well |
|---|---|---|---|
| 1 | Iceland | ~$0.80-0.85 | Finance, Insurance, Tech |
| 2 | Luxembourg | ~$0.65-0.74 | Legal, Finance, Business |
| 3 | United States | ~$0.60-1.50+ | All high-value niches (finance, SaaS, health) |
| 4 | Australia | ~$0.50-1.10+ | Education, Health, Tech |
| 5 | United Kingdom | ~$0.45-1.20+ | Real Estate, Finance, Legal |
| 6 | Canada | ~$0.45-1.20+ | Tech, Finance, E-commerce |
| 7 | Finland | ~$0.45 | Tech, Gaming, Business |
| 8 | Austria | ~$0.45 | Finance, Education |
| 9 | New Zealand | ~$0.30-0.40+ | Travel, Business, SaaS |
| 10 | Sweden | ~$0.30-0.40 | Tech, Startups, Finance |
| 11 | Ireland | ~$0.30-0.40 | Finance, Business |
| 12 | Singapore | ~$0.25-0.30+ | Tech, SaaS, Business |
| 13 | Germany | ~$0.40-0.90+ | Auto, Finance, Health |
Key Takeaways & What Influences CPC
- Advertiser competition is high in developed economies like the US, UK, and Australia.
- Purchasing power of audiences is greater in high-income countries, so advertisers pay more.
- Niche selection matters — finance, legal, insurance, SaaS, and health usually deliver the highest CPCs.
- Traffic quality: Organic, engaged traffic from premium countries gets rewarded with higher CPC.
- Language & economy: English-speaking countries or wealthy nations with strong GDP generally yield better CPC rates.
The above is the list of the top-paying, high CPC countries. But to speak frankly, this information is not provided by Google. Google does not disclose this kind of information to anyone.
This list is sorted by various observations and earnings summaries. You can assume that these sites are in the highest CPC paying countries. These are the results obtained by professional bloggers.

Image Source: Most Expensive Keywords in Google Ads
Frequently Asked Questions (FAQs) on High CPC Keywords & Countries
Which niche has the highest CPC?
Finance, insurance, and legal niches usually have the highest CPC. Advertisers are willing to pay more to acquire valuable customers.
What does it mean when CPC is high?
A high CPC indicates that advertisers are competing strongly for clicks. This usually happens because the audience or keyword has a high conversion value.
What makes CPC high?
High CPC is influenced by advertiser competition, niche profitability, audience location, and traffic quality.
What is a high CPC?
A high CPC is generally considered above $1 per click, but it varies by country and niche.
Which countries have the highest AdSense CPC?
Countries like the US, UK, Australia, Canada, and Iceland often top the list. This is due to higher purchasing power and strong advertiser demand.
How do I increase my AdSense CPC?
Focus on high-value keywords, write content in profitable niches, target traffic from premium countries, and improve user engagement.
Does traffic source affect CPC?
Yes, organic search traffic usually brings higher CPC compared to social or low-quality traffic, as advertisers value engaged readers.
Are high CPC keywords good for all bloggers?
Not always. High CPC keywords are competitive. They work best if your content is high-quality and you can attract traffic from premium countries.
Can CPC change over time?
Yes, CPC rates fluctuate based on advertiser budgets, seasons (like holidays), and overall demand in a niche.
Is CPC the only factor for AdSense earnings?
No. Earnings also depend on CTR (click-through rate), ad placements, website traffic, and audience behavior.
Conclusion
Your Adsense earnings largely depend on the keywords you select for your content. The most effective way to generate passive income from Google Adsense is to target keywords with low competition. Ensure these keywords have high CPC. So, begin your search for high CPC keywords today and boost your earnings.
One highly recommended tool to assist you in this process is SEMrush. SEMrush is an all-in-one digital marketing platform. It offers powerful keyword research features. This platform allows you to identify high CPC keywords relevant to your niche.
By using SEMrush, you can analyze your competitors’ top-performing keywords. You can also explore keyword difficulty. Additionally, filter keywords based on cost per click.
Use these AdSense high paying keywords 2025 for niches with the best competition. The list of top paying Google AdSense keywords will help you boost your AdSense revenue in 2025.
This helps you focus your content strategy on the most profitable keywords. It improves your chances of ranking higher on search engines and increases your Adsense revenue.
In short, AdSense high paying keywords 2025 are essential. High CPC keywords 2025 give you an advantage over other paying AdSense keywords. These keywords help maximize earnings with the highest CPC AdSense keywords.
Starting with SEMrush’s free trial or basic account can provide valuable insights to kickstart your keyword research journey effectively.







Insurance is a good niche but it requires deep knowledge and experience to write on this topic.
It is not that easy as it seems
By the way, thanks a lot Satish for sharing this amazing post. This will help me and other fellow bloggers just too much.
High CPC keywords matter too much for us ☺
Once again, thanks a lot
And also, “The fact is, it’s not necessary to drive lots of traffic if you are getting high CPC rates.”